Attorney General to Establish Rules for Return of Property

8 GCA § 150.20 — under Disposition of Property.

8 GCA § 150.20

Not Needed as Evidence. Property held by any law enforcement agency which is not needed for evidentiary purposes in a criminal action may be returned by the agency under rules and regulations established by the Attorney General. NOTE: Section 150.20 provides the Attorney General with the administrative authority to determine whether and under what conditions property will be released. His rules and regulations should, of course, require the person to whom property is returned to show his identity and right to possession. However, if release is not obtained pursuant to this Section, a person claiming a right to possession may always proceed under §§ 150.30 through 150.50.
